Stress doesn’t always scream—it whispers. Here are 5 hidden signs you shouldn’t ignore.

We often associate stress with obvious symptoms like anxiety or insomnia, but it can sneak into our lives in subtle, surprising ways. Spotting these hidden signs early can help protect your mental and physical health.

Hidden Signs of Stress You Might Be Missing
- Memory lapses or forgetfulness Struggling to recall names, appointments, or tasks? Chronic stress can impair your brain’s ability to store and retrieve information.
- Digestive issues Bloating, constipation, or stomach cramps may not just be dietary, they could be your gut reacting to prolonged stress.
- Increased irritability Snapping at loved ones or feeling constantly annoyed? Stress can lower your emotional tolerance, making small frustrations feel overwhelming.
- Frequent colds or infections Stress weakens your immune system, leaving you more vulnerable to illness, even if you’re eating well and sleeping enough.
- Changes in appetite Overeating, undereating, or craving sugar and carbs can be your body’s way of coping with emotional strain.

Recognising these signs is the first step toward managing stress before it spirals. Whether it’s through mindfulness, movement, or talking to a professional, small shifts can make a big difference.

Big news for mental health care in Australia: national standards for counsellors and psychotherapists are here and that’s a win for clients.
📣 PACFA has welcomed the Australian Government’s endorsement of new National Standards for Counsellors and Psychotherapists, a landmark move that sets clear expectations for education, ethics, supervision, and practice across the profession.

Here’s why this matters for our clients:
✅ Greater confidence: With consistent national standards, clients can trust they’re receiving care from qualified, ethical professionals.
🧠 Better access: The standards pave the way for counsellors to be more widely integrated into primary care, schools, and community services, reducing wait times and improving support.
🤝 Equity and recognition: Counsellors and psychotherapists are now more clearly aligned with other allied health professionals, ensuring clients get the care they need, when and where they need it.

This is a huge step toward a more inclusive, responsive, and high-quality mental health system.

🌟 5 Secret Habits of Happy People

They practice kindness without expecting anything back. Whether it’s holding a door, checking in on a friend, or giving a compliment, happy people make kindness a reflex, not a performance.

They celebrate others’ wins. Instead of comparing or competing, they genuinely cheer others on. This “positive empathy” boosts emotional intelligence and deepens relationships.

They make time for connection. It’s not about big events, it’s about being present. A quick call, a shared laugh, or a distraction-free dinner builds trust and belonging.|

They find joy in small moments. Happy people seek out laughter, playfulness, and lightness. Even a silly meme or a goofy joke can shift the mood and spark joy.

They contribute to something bigger than themselves. Whether it’s volunteering, supporting a cause, or helping a neighbour, having purpose fuels long-term happiness and meaning.

Ever heard of Spoon Theory? It’s a powerful metaphor used by people with chronic illness to explain energy limitations. Imagine starting each day with a handful of spoons—each one representing the energy it takes to shower, cook, work, socialise. Once you run out, that’s it. No more reserves.

For those living with invisible illnesses, every task costs a spoon. And some days, there just aren’t enough.

In therapy, it’s common to share parts of your story that might feel “ordinary” to you. However, as your psychotherapist, I pay attention to much more than just your words:
1️⃣ The emotions underlying your thoughts and expressions
2️⃣ Shifts in your tone or body language
3️⃣ Patterns in how you approach relationships or challenges
4️⃣ The strengths and resilience that may be hidden under self-doubt
5️⃣ Coping strategies you’ve developed, even if they no longer fully serve you
6️⃣ The values and aspirations shaping your decisions
7️⃣ Small but meaningful signs of growth you might not notice in yourself

Therapy isn’t just about solving problems; it’s about creating a safe space where you feel seen, understood, and supported. Reflecting on these insights can help you view yourself with greater compassion and clarity.
